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2009.11.08;
Скачать: CL | DM;

Вниз

Java   Найти похожие ветки 

 
Andy BitOff ©   (2009-09-07 08:56) [0]

Назрела необходимость в изучении сего продукта. Посоветуйте книжки, желательно бумажные, начиная с синтаксиса и т.д. Еще посоветуйте среду, если таковые есть, думаю должны быть. И сайтики полезные.


 
test ©   (2009-09-07 09:04) [1]

Б. Эккель, Философия Java.


 
pavel_guzhanov ©   (2009-09-07 09:04) [2]

Хорстманн. Java2. Библиотека профессионала. Два тома. На мой взгляд - самая лучшая книга.
Еще Дейтелы. Технологии программирования на Java. Трехтомник. Первый том на бумаге найти проблематично, остальные тома есть в магазинах.

Из сред разработки пробовал три: Intelij IDEA, Eclipse и NetBeans.

IDEA - не понравилась совсем, к тому же она еще и платная.
Eclipse - хорошая среда, только надо поставить нужные плагины
NetBeans - понравилась больше всех, сейчас ей и пользуюсь.

Все вышеизложенное - ИМХО.

PS. NetBeans сейчас выложена для скачивания версии 6.7. У этой версии есть даже русский интерфейс, правда я пользуюсь 6.5 английской, и русскую скачивать не рискую :о)


 
test ©   (2009-09-07 09:05) [3]

Б. Эккель, Философия Java.
Синтаксис, 2 и 4 версии сильно разные(переписаны взгляды на обработку exception).


 
Andy BitOff ©   (2009-09-07 09:17) [4]


> pavel_guzhanov ©   (07.09.09 09:04) [2]

Спасибо, за исчерпывающий ответ.
И тебе, test ©, спасибо.

NetBeans уже качаю ;)

Книжки поищу.


> test ©   (07.09.09 09:05) [3]
> Синтаксис, 2 и 4 версии сильно разные

В смысле версии языка? Дык, тогда поновее, конечно.


 
pavel_guzhanov ©   (2009-09-07 09:24) [5]

Неплохой форум по Java на SQL.ru. Но, большая часть вопросов решается JavaDocs.
Меня когда-то научил Юрий Зотов: В гугле задаешь запрос такого типа: "jTable javadocs". Первые же ссылки ведут на исчерпывающую документацию по jTable. И так по большинству тем.


 
test ©   (2009-09-07 09:29) [6]

Andy BitOff ©   (07.09.09 09:17) [4]
1 версия делать ничего не умеет
2 продолжает традиции 1 версии
3 уже что то пытается делать но очень много сторонних библиотек надо качать
4 версия рабочая лошадка, но многое надо будет качать
5 версия добавлены регулярки и прочая, качать миниум
6 версия добавлено управление удаленным экземпляром JVM по сети, еще более расширен
дальше не следил

Я вообще то про книги, у Эккеля 1 версия книги сильно отличается от 4, обычно советуеют читать 2. ))


 
AntiZOG   (2009-09-08 04:16) [7]

Рекомендую Хорстмена.
://bookzone.com.ua/Netshop/catalogue/catalogue_26484.html
://bookzone.com.ua/Netshop/catalogue/catalogue_18438.html

Это как Флёнов, но без бреда и ошибок.

Информация по существу и в интересном стиле изложения с кучей кода и примеров (и без глюков). Кроме того отдельно в каждой главе акцентируются определённые фичи Java для данной главы.


 
Rule ©   (2009-09-08 18:20) [8]

Я присоединяюсь к рекомендации по поводу Эккеля.
По поводу ИДЕ. Очень сильно рекомендую сначала руками все поделать без ИДЕ.
А потом после осознания базовых основ очень рекомендую Idea. ИМХО лучше ничего не видел больше ни под один язык. Кто говорит что не очень хорошая - значит не разобрался. Эклипсом долго пользовался и Идеей. Нетбинс осилил только на неделю. Очень не понравилось, но осознаю что впечатление чисто субьективное.

Жалко таких тулзов как Идея нету под С++ :-)


 
rule ©   (2009-09-08 20:11) [9]

да и кстати для Идеи Open Source License доступна для бесплатного скачивания. Все тоже но можно создавать только опенсорсный код.
А персональная лицензия стоит все лишь 250 долларов.


 
test ©   (2009-09-08 21:18) [10]

Rule ©   (08.09.09 18:20) [8]
code::block ИМХО то же самое под C++.
Правда про рефакторинг можно забыть.(*или я не нашел*)


 
Kostafey ©   (2009-09-09 19:47) [11]

Да, литературы по java - вагон, а
вот про такую глобальную книженцию найти -
проблема.

Сам последнее время пользую
James Gosling, Bill Joy, Guy Steele and Gilad Bracha
The Java Language Specification Third Edition

Для тех кто только начинает изучение - читать Хабибуллина
(по-моему называется Самоучитель Java 2).

А так - javadoc - лучший справочник, еще его к IDE
прикрутить для удобства.

А что до холивара IDEA vs Eclipse vs NetBeans.
Немного работал со всеми, но более всего с IDEA.

Eclipse - наверно не так плох, но много мороки с плагинами
(одни попддерживают другую версию IDE, другие зависят от других
версий других плагинов, но если требуемый плагин таки установить,
то может половина ранее установленных плагинов отвалится).

NetBeans - ИМХО для JSE (разработки десктоп-приложений идеален).
Мало мороки с натройкой ИДЕ + чудный визуальный редактор - аля Delphi.
Косяк - не поддерживает нужную мне версию веб-сервера.

IDEA - легкая и функциональная ИДЕ, но, как было сказано выше, небесплатная.


 
Омлет   (2009-09-09 23:18) [12]

> IDEA - легкая и функциональная ИДЕ

Легкая? Это самая мощная ИДЕ для java. С ней разбираться неделю надо, особенно, если крупный проект.
Уж лучше старый добрый, иногда глючный Эклипс, под который есть мульен плагинов )


 
test ©   (2009-09-10 06:12) [13]

Омлет   (09.09.09 23:18) [12]
Самая мощная JBuilder но работать с ней не очень.


 
Kostafey ©   (2009-09-10 07:43) [14]


> [12] Омлет   (09.09.09 23:18)
> Легкая? Это самая мощная ИДЕ для java.

Легкая - я имел в виду в плане ресурсоемкости.
А в плане ложности освоения... я бы не сказал, что
Eclipse проще.


> [13] test ©   (10.09.09 06:12)
> Самая мощная JBuilder но работать с ней не очень.

JBuilder - удобная, но крайне тяжелая и неповоротливая IDE,
как и JDeveloper 11. На 1 Гб RAM лучше вообще не ставить.


 
Kostafey ©   (2009-09-10 07:43) [15]

> ложности

сложности


 
test ©   (2009-09-10 07:55) [16]

Омлет   (09.09.09 23:18) [12]
C JBuilder поболе разбираться надо, чем неделю. Авторы книг под копирку учебники про Дельфи на JBuilder тянут!



Страницы: 1 вся ветка

Текущий архив: 2009.11.08;
Скачать: CL | DM;

Наверх




Память: 0.51 MB
Время: 0.016 c
2-1253744769
Chorniyy
2009-09-24 02:26
2009.11.08
Можно ли занять память таким способом


15-1252052592
Kerk
2009-09-04 12:23
2009.11.08
Войнушка программ. "Вирусы"


15-1252528212
Юрий
2009-09-10 00:30
2009.11.08
С днем рождения ! 10 сентября 2009 четверг


4-1221548514
dmitry_12_08_73
2008-09-16 11:01
2009.11.08
Декодирование комбинации клавиш


8-1198623882
POMbI4
2007-12-26 02:04
2009.11.08
Реализация алгоритма слежения за объектом.